Where this album fits
- Career context
- Released on October 6, 2023, 'Javelin' is Sufjan Stevens' first studio album since 'The Ascension' (2020), marking a return to his layered storytelling and eclectic soundscapes. This album further solidifies his evolution as an artist who blends personal reflection with broader themes, continuing to explore new musical territories.
